The forerunner to this book - Ryder, Mir & Freeman's 'An Aid tothe MRCP Short Cases' - rapidly established itself as a classic andhas sold over 30,000 copies.
The new Progressive Assessment of Clinical Examination Skills(PACES) has replaced the old short case exam and, as a result, theauthors have revised, reworked and extended their highly successfultext so that it continues to address the study needs of candidates. This new revision aid is now presented in two volumes:
* * An Aid to the MRCP PACES Volume 1: Stations 1, 3 and 5
* * An Aid to the MRCP PACES Volume 2: Stations 2 and 4
This Volume covers Station 2 'History Taking' and Station 4'Communication Skills'. In the 'History Taking' section at least 50examples of each type of question and case are included, togetherwith scenarios with simulated patients. The focus of the book isvery much on the examiners' expectations so that candidates have atrue picture of the areas on which they are being tested.
Station 4 'Communication Skills' also covers the ethical issuesin the doctor-patient relationship, such as managing organtransplantation, consenting for hospital post-mortem, etc.
Also included in this Volume is the 'Experiences and Anecdotes'chapter providing real quotes from both candidates and examiners -this helps the candidate to avoid the more common pitfalls of theexam.
